What is the typical ROI of Microsoft 365 Copilot?

Copilot ROI can vary widely by organization, so companies should treat generic estimates with caution. That said, the most-cited benchmark is a Forrester Total Economic Impact study commissioned by Microsoft, which projected a three-year ROI ranging from 132% to 353% for small and medium-sized businesses.

Of course, this is a modeled projection rather than an analysis of real business results. Companies should take these numbers with a grain of salt, particularly since Microsoft commissioned the study.

In our experience, Microsoft Copilot ROI typically ranges from 50-200%. Many factors affect overall ROI, so it’s important to understand them.

How much does Microsoft 365 Copilot cost per user?

How much does Microsoft 365 Copilot cost per user?

Microsoft 365 Copilot is an add-on license, not a standalone product, so the per-user price depends on which tier you buy and which qualifying Microsoft 365 base plan you have. For most organizations, the headline figures are $18/user/month for Copilot Business (SMB, up to 300 users) rising to a standard $21, and $32/user/month for Microsoft Copilot 365 Business Premium, both on annual commitments. Note that month-to-month commitments are priced higher.

Are Microsoft’s Copilot ROI claims (like 353%) realistic?

The 353% figure is best understood as a reasonable ceiling under favorable conditions, not a typical result. It comes from a Forrester Total Economic Impact study that Microsoft commissioned, and it’s the high end of a modeled 132%–353% return over a three-year range. The projection is built on a composite organization rather than audited outcomes from real deployments.

Projections like these tend to assume strong adoption and fully realized time savings, so treating 353% as the expected return could be overly optimistic for some organizations. That said, dismissing the whole range as vendor spin is also unwise, as the analysis contains many important factors that organizations should consider when projecting their own ROI from Microsoft Copilot.

The vast majority of companies can achieve real ROI from Copilot. The exact percentage depends on many factors, including thoroughness of data preparation, breadth of deployment, user training, time reinvestment, and accuracy of ROI measurement.

What hidden costs affect Copilot ROI?

User licensing isn’t the only cost associated with leveraging Microsoft Copilot. Factors like licensing prerequisites, data cleanup, training, and change management can create additional costs that may not be obvious when an organization hasn’t launched Copilot before.

Here are some less-obvious costs and what you can do to manage them.

Hidden cost

Potential effect on ROI

How to manage it

Licensing prerequisites

Copilot is an add-on that requires a qualifying Microsoft 365 base plan; organizations on older or lower tiers (e.g., Office 365 E3) must upgrade first.

Audit current licensing before budgeting; calculate the all-in cost (base plan + upgrade + Copilot) per user; sequence upgrades only for the roles that will actually use Copilot rather than the whole tenant.

Data-governance cleanup

Copilot inherits your existing permissions, so oversharing, stale SharePoint sites, and mislabeled files may allow Copilot to surface sensitive content to the wrong internal users. Data cleanup may be required as part of the rollout or on a continual basis, which comes with its own cost.

Run a permissions and oversharing audit before rollout; apply sensitivity labels and access controls (e.g., Purview, SharePoint Advanced Management); pilot with a clean, well-scoped data set before expanding tenant-wide.

Training & prompt enablement

Licenses don’t automatically create business value. Users who don’t know how to prompt effectively may abandon the tool or get mediocre output. This lack of proper training can undermine the real ROI potential of the tool.

Provide role-based training and a prompt library; designate and support internal champions; set adoption targets and revisit them; treat enablement as ongoing, not a one-time kickoff.

Change management

New tools often fail due to entrenched user processes rather than lack of features. Without deliberate behavior change, users may not fully adopt Microsoft Copilot, which leaves real ROI potential on the table.

Secure the backing of the leadership team; integrate Copilot into existing workflows and standard operating procedures; communicate wins; phase the rollout so behavior change is reinforced rather than mandated all at once.

Output review & rework

Copilot outputs may require fact-checking and editing, particularly if users engage the tool without sufficient training on how to prompt it. Poor outputs can erase the productivity gains that Copilot is meant to create.

For initial rollout, prioritize use cases where AI is genuinely faster and better; build lightweight review steps into workflows; track net (not gross) time saved so expectations stay realistic.

Ongoing measurement & administration

If no one tracks usage and ties it to outcomes, you can’t prove value, optimize, or reclaim unused licenses.

Use Copilot usage/adoption analytics; review active-usage rates regularly; reallocate or reclaim dormant licenses; report value against a pre-deployment baseline.

Why do some Copilot rollouts get stuck before showing ROI?

Why do some Copilot rollouts get stuck before showing ROI?

Most stalled Copilot rollouts don’t fail because the technology doesn’t work or the use case isn’t real. Rather, they fail because the organization treats deployment as a licensing event and a software rollout rather than a change program. It’s far too easy to buy seats, hand them out, and expect productivity to appear on its own.

In this scenario, usage spikes with initial curiosity and then decays. This happens because essential functions like enablement, governance, workflow integration, and productivity measurement weren’t baked into the project. The rollout gets stuck in an expensive pilot: licenses are paid for, but active usage stays too low to generate returns worth measuring.

Here’s what that looks like in detail:

  • Licenses handed out without enablement. Users don’t know how to prompt effectively, so they get mediocre results and quietly abandon the tool.
  • No executive sponsorship or change management. Without visible leadership and deliberate behavior change, new habits never take hold, and usage decays after the novelty fades.
  • Copilot isn’t embedded in real operational workflows. When Copilot lives beside daily work rather than inside it, people forget to use it and revert to old habits.
  • Poor data governance underneath. Oversharing, stale sites, and messy permissions create untrustworthy or risky outputs. This hurts user confidence and slows expansion.
  • Prerequisites and readiness underestimated. Data and permissions cleanup can hurt a rollout if they weren’t dealt with before launching Copilot.
  • No measurement baseline. Without pre-deployment metrics and usage tracking, teams can’t prove the value of Copilot.

How long does it take to see ROI from Microsoft 365 Copilot?

Most organizations should plan for measurable Copilot ROI on a 12-to-36-month horizon rather than a matter of weeks. Early productivity signals, such as time saved on drafting, summarizing, and searching, often appear within the first few months. That said, converting those minutes into demonstrable financial return takes longer, as it depends on adoption reaching a critical mass.

Time-to-ROI usually depends on deployment complexity: how ready the data and governance are, how many roles are involved, and the amount of discipline applied to change management and measurement.

Here’s what that looks like in detail.

Rollout type

Typical profile

Approximate time to ROI

Simple

Small user group or single department; clean, well-organized data; existing governance; high-value use cases targeted first; strong enablement from day one

~12 months

Moderate

Multiple teams or departments; mixed data readiness requiring some cleanup; governance and change management built during rollout; phased expansion

~18–24 months

Complex

Large or multi-site organization; regulated/sensitive data; significant data-governance and permissions remediation; heavy change management; broad role coverage

~24–36 month

 

How can we launch Copilot with a strong track to ROI?

The organizations that hit their Copilot ROI targets treat the launch as a structured adoption program, not a licensing transaction. They do the readiness work before seats go live, such as cleaning up data and permissions, targeting the roles and use cases with strong AI potential, and fully training users.

Here are the detailed, foundational aspects of a Copilot rollout with a strong track to ROI:

  • Executive sponsorship: Visible leadership backing that signals the program matters and sustains it past the initial novelty period.
  • A clear business case with a baseline: Defined objectives and pre-deployment metrics so value can be measured, proven, and optimized later.
  • Data governance and permissions cleanup: Audit oversharing, remediate stale sites, and apply sensitivity labels so Copilot surfaces trustworthy, appropriately scoped content (critical in regulated environments).
  • Right-fit use cases and roles first: Start where AI meaningfully accelerates real work, so early wins build momentum and validate the business case.
  • Prerequisite and licensing readiness: Confirm qualifying base plans and budget the all-in per-seat cost before rollout, avoiding mid-launch surprises.
  • Role-based training and prompt enablement: Practical, ongoing coaching and a prompt library so users get good results and keep using the tool.
  • Internal champions: Designated power users who model usage, answer questions, and drive peer adoption.
  • Workflow integration: Embed Copilot inside daily tools and standard operating procedures rather than beside them, so usage becomes habit.
  • Change management: Deliberate communication, reinforcement, and celebration of wins to make new behaviors stick.
  • Measurement and iteration: Track adoption and usage analytics against the baseline, reclaim idle licenses, and refine as you scale.
  • A phased scaling plan: A resourced path (owner, budget, milestones) from pilot to tenant-wide, so the program grows instead of plateauing.
